'The Filipinos Are Worth It!' —Kris Aquino's Response to the Filipino Nation for the Love and Respect Showered Upon Her Mom Cory Aquino, August 5 2009

5 August 2009

Transcript of Kris Aquino response to the Filipino people for the overwhelming show of love and respect for the late President Cory Aquino, Manila Cathedral, August 5, 2009.  It is part eulogy and part message of thanks, emotional and authentic, delivered in a way only Kris Aquino can, certainly one of the most moving messages of its kind in recorded history. 

'Minamahal kong mga kababayan,' yun po ang opening line ng Mommy namin everytime na kakausapin niya ang bayan.  In a very specific way, that sums up exactly how our family feels. What words can I use to convey to all of you, the depth of our gratitude for the respect, appreciation and love that you've showered upon our Mother?  How do we say thank you for the expressions of sympathy and support for our family during our time of bereavement?

Come to think of it, from March of 2008, you were one with us in praying for our Mom's healing.

Paano po ba kami makakapagpasalamat sa inyong lahat sa effort ninyong pumila sa gitna ng matinding init at malakas na pagbuhos ng ulan ... para po masulyapan ang Mommy namin, magbigay respeto at maipagdasal siya sa huling pagkakataon?

Isa po sa huling binilin ng Mom sa akin ay ang magpasalamat po ako sa inyong lahat. You have given our family honor beyond anything we could ever have hoped to receive that no matter how great the sacrifices of my parents, I can honestly say to all of you, that for my family, the Filipinos are worth it!  (applause)

Allow me please to speak in my Mom's voice so that I can share with you her wishes for our country that she instilled in us by virtue of her example. Mom believed that true public service did not end when one's term of office ended. She continued selflessly working for the betterment of the lives of our countrymen.  Immediately after my Dad's assassination, she set up a foundation in my Dad's honor to help further my Dad's advocacy started when he first held elective office ... of helping deserving students fulfill their dream of  a college education. 

I continue to meet a lot of people, some a lot, some a little older than me, some a decade younger.  They proudly tell me that they are Ninoy's scholars.   

Mom believed because of her experience of having to raise us single-handedly during my Dad's incarceration and after his assassination and the importance of empowering women. In her later life, she did this through her support of microfinance programs ... by giving women viable means of livelihood ... masisiguro na maayos at maginhawa ang pamumuhay ng bawat pamilyang Pilipino.

Dahil po binuwis ng Dad namin ang buhay niya para makamit natin ang kalayaan, ang Mom namin, inalagaan at pinaglaban ang demokrasya natin tuwing may makita siyang pagmamalabis sa hawak na kapangyarihan. Para po sa kaniya, kailanman, hindi mo pwedeng biguin ang tiwalang ipinagkaloob sa 'yo ng taumbayan.

For her, silence and passivity were never options. Above everything else, she had a deep faith in God, an unwavering belief in the power of prayer, a more personal devotion and relationship with Mama Mary.  She was unwavering in her faith in the innate goodness of every Filipino. 

While it's true that she was overwhelmed with gratitude for the prayers people were offering for her healing, she never failed to mention that we must pray for all those who were suffering from illness and other forms of pain. She would always reach out in compassion to those she felt were in distress.  And she reminded us constantly that we must pray for each other.
